IP101: What is a Patent?

A patent is a form of intellectual property that grants the owner, or assignee, a temporary monopoly on the claimed technology for a specific term (currently, 20 years). There are many different types of patents, and the patent type will depend on the type of technology the patent is claiming. The right granted by a …
